Indian Navy conducts “Julley Ladakh”, an outreach program to engage with youth and civil society

The Indian Navy is running the “Julley Ladakh” outreach initiative in Ladakh to involve the local youth and civic society while also raising awareness of the service there. Vice Chief of Naval Staff Sanjay Jasjit Singh started off a 5,000-kilometer motorbike expedition today at the National War Memorial. Similar efforts had previously been made by the Navy in the North East, and they were incredibly successful. In order to interact with residents in all coastal States, it has also launched the Sam No Varunah automobile adventure.
